SOLAR CONSIDERATIONS

If you think you are all set to fit solar panels on your property in Sudbury, you need to think about these points:

  1. Does your roof face south or south-west? - Solar energy panels must face this direction in the Northern Hemisphere to absorb the maximum possible amount of power from the sun's rays.
  2. Does your property's roof have any overgrown trees or tall buildings that throw shade on it? - Shade can reduce the effectiveness of solar panels and severe shading can make them virtually useless.
  3. Do you own a property that will need planning permission to install solar panels? - In the majority of scenarios you will not need to have planning permission on your Sudbury home for solar energy installations on your roof. However if you have a flat roof, have a listed building or live in a conservation area, you will want to confer with your local authority of any constraints that might affect you.
  4. What effect on property values can solar panel installations have? - Solar panels have been known to both positively and negatively influence house prices. As consciousness grows concerning climate changes and the environment, it has been observed that the positive effects on property prices have grown.

There are professional organisations, trade bodies and associations which are specific to the solar installation industry. For every aspect of solar, and sustainable energy generation systems, these organisations provide training, support and qualifications on all working practices, equipment and health & safety. When you are on the lookout for a contractor to do your solar panel installation in Sudbury, you should give preference to one that is a registered member of one of these associations.

STA (Solar Trade Association) - Provides trailblazing technology training and solutions by working closely with industry, Government and local authorities, as well as leading figures in the green and solar energy industry. The STA is a well-respected trade organisation in the solar industry and its members range from small-scale household installers to massive multi-national companies.

MCS - The MCS (Microgeneration Certification Scheme) is the mark that all solar products, and solar panel installers, should have in the United Kingdom. MCS recognition is an indication of good quality for any solar company, and for all the renewable energy equipment that it supplies. The Microgeneration Certification Scheme encourages and supports the following low-carbon technologies: air source heat pumps, solar battery storage, solar panels and biomass heating systems.

REA (Renewable Energy Association) - The REA is Britain's primary trade body for the green energy and clean technology sector. It has approximately five hundred and fifty companies who are members and is invested in providing training and moulding policy towards a zero carbon economy . The REA is a not-for-profit operation and its members include: fuel producers, project developers, energy generators, service providers, installers and equipment manufacturers. These cover anything from sole traders right up to vast multi-national companies.

Solar Panel Batteries

If you want to store the energy that's generated by your solar PV panels for later use, this can be done through the use of batteries. It can be used to power your home, phone or appliances. Your exact needs will determine the size and capacity of batteries that you buy. For example, just one battery may not be enough if you regularly use an air conditioner or refridgerator.

Solar Battery Storage

The DoD (Depth of Discharge) should certainly be considered, when you're buying solar batteries for your energy system. The longest lasting batteries have a higher DoD. The least cost-effective batteries are the ones that are degraded or over discharged, because less power is stored. The capacity of a solar battery is crucial, because it determines how much electricity you can use.

At night and when the sun's shining, the charged batteries will be available to use for your electricity needs. This means you'll still be saving money even when your solar system aren't producing energy. Cheap energy will still be available to use, even on cloudy and dark days when less power is being generated. You can also receive payments back from the electricity company for the energy you don't use. When there's a power cut, this is especially useful. Ground Source Heating Systems

Ground source heating systems, known as geothermal heating systems as well, employ the stable earth temperature as an energy source to warm homes and buildings situated in Sudbury. This renewable energy source is highly efficient and eco-friendly because it reduces carbon emissions and eliminates the dependence on fossil fuels.

Ground Source Heating Systems Sudbury

The circulation of a antifreeze and water mixture through pipes buried deep in the ground allows a ground source heating system to absorb heat from the earth and convey it to a heat pump. The heat pump then amplifies the heat and distributes it throughout the building.

Despite having a higher initial cost than traditional heating systems, ground source heating systems can help home and business owners save money in the long run through lower maintenance costs and reduced energy bills. Geothermal heating systems are a great option for those who want a sustainable and long-term heating solution because they are highly durable and can last for several years.

Financial incentives such as grants and rebates are available from some governments to home and property owners who install ground source heating systems, making them a more accessible and affordable option for those interested in increasing energy efficiency and reducing their carbon footprint. In brief, ground source heating systems offer an environmentally and sustainable solution for heating and cooling homes and buildings in Sudbury, while also providing durability and long-term cost savings.
